Output 63e1de933f87777e82f2ad38a40924375fb328daadf02144e6100ae5b1651502:212

value
70276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 430070c35220c415fc5e1459365339eb61688d21 OP_EQUAL
address
37oHj13K534i2FQvdTNxgPe9R5shXNUBQK
transaction
63e1de933f87777e82f2ad38a40924375fb328daadf02144e6100ae5b1651502
spent
true